Binance’s CZ Proposes Bitcoin, BNB for Kyrgyzstan’s National Crypto Reserves


by Abimbola Adu
for BTC-Pulse

Share:

CZ meets Kyrgyz officials to propose Bitcoin, BNB for national crypto reserves

CZ Recommends Bitcoin, BNB for Kyrgyzstan’s Crypto Reserves

Binance co-founder Changpeng “CZ” Zhao has recommended that Kyrgyzstan begin its national crypto reserves with Bitcoin and Binance Coin (BNB). On May 5, Zhao tweeted on X (formerly Twitter) that the two cryptocurrencies would be a good foundation for the country’s reserve strategy.

The proposal aligns with Zhao’s role in advising Kyrgyzstan’s National Investment Agency (NIA) on crypto and blockchain-related frameworks. He’s already indicated he’s been giving similar advice—both officially and unofficially—to several governments around the world and is finding the work “extremely meaningful.”

Binance Pay Launches with Government Partnership

A day preceding Zhao’s tweet, Binance signed a memorandum of understanding (MOU) with the NIA on May 4 to launch Binance Pay in Kyrgyzstan. The cryptocurrency payment solution will allow customers in the country to conduct payments using digital assets, further expanding the exchange’s presence in Central Asia.

In addition to the payment service, the partnership includes a multi-faceted educational component. Binance Academy will collaborate with Kyrgyz government agencies to introduce blockchain-based programs, with the aim to reskill citizens and build a technologically savvy workforce.

Kyrgyzstan Drives Digital Asset Adoption

Kyrgyzstan is making additional moves to join the crypto-friendly nations. President Sadyr Zhaparov signed into law on April 17 a central bank digital currency (CBDC) pilot program. The law also provides for the legal tender status of the digital Kyrgyz som.

Gold-Backed Stablecoin Being Developed

In addition to its digital finance ambitions, Kyrgyzstan is also reportedly to introduce a U.S. dollar-pegged gold-backed stablecoin. Temporarily named the Gold Dollar (USDKG), it will be collateralized by $500 million in gold by the country’s Ministry of Finance. While unconfirmed by officials, this would be another significant step in linking traditional and blockchain-based finance.
